Steam numbers only show you players playing the game through steam. Steam numbers do NOT show how many people are actually playing the game overall. Steam does not show you blizzard server numbers.
Thats the point Avalon is trying to get across.
Steam metrics are only the end all be all for games exclusively on steam. 9-10 million copies sold on release yet steams max players for diablo 4 all time is 55k. So get that steam comparison crap outa here lol. I am not saying the game is in a great state but lets be fair about it.

No, Blizzard servers do not share with Steam servers because Steam and Battle.net are separate, unaffiliated platforms. Battle.net licenses cannot be transferred or exchanged for Steam versions.
However, some Blizzard games are available on Steam, including Overwatch 2. Cross-play is also available for some Blizzard games, including Call of Duty, Hearthstone, Diablo Immortal, Diablo IV, and Overwatch 2.
You can unlink your Battle.net account from Steam, Xbox Live, Playstation Network, or Nintendo Switch at any time. To do this, you can:
- Log in to your Connections in your Account Management page
- Click the Disconnect button next to the console you want to unlink
